Step-by-step Precision Turbo Installation on a 2jz-gte Engine

Installing a Precision Turbo on a 2JZ-GTE engine can significantly enhance performance. This guide provides a detailed, step-by-step process to ensure a successful installation.

Tools and Materials Needed

  • Precision Turbo Kit
  • Socket Set
  • Torque Wrench
  • Wrenches
  • Boost Controller
  • Silicone Hose Clamps
  • Gaskets
  • Oil Feed Line
  • Oil Drain Line
  • Coolant Lines
  • Safety Glasses
  • Gloves

Preparation

Before starting the installation, ensure that the engine is cool and the vehicle is parked on a flat surface. Gather all the necessary tools and materials listed above.

Step 1: Remove the Stock Turbo

Begin by disconnecting the battery. Next, remove the intake piping and any accessories obstructing access to the stock turbo. Carefully detach the exhaust manifold and remove the stock turbo from the engine bay.

Step 2: Prepare the Precision Turbo

Inspect the Precision Turbo and ensure all components are included. Install the oil feed line and oil drain line onto the turbo. Ensure that the gaskets are in good condition and ready for installation.

Step 3: Install the Turbo

Position the Precision Turbo onto the exhaust manifold. Align the mounting holes and secure the turbo using the appropriate bolts. Use a torque wrench to tighten the bolts to the manufacturer’s specifications.

Step 4: Connect Oil and Coolant Lines

Connect the oil feed line to the turbo, ensuring it is properly secured. Next, attach the oil drain line, followed by the coolant lines. Check for any potential leaks before proceeding.

Step 5: Reinstall Intake and Exhaust Components

Reattach the intake piping and any other components that were removed during the disassembly. Ensure all clamps and bolts are tightened securely.

Step 6: Install Boost Controller

If your setup includes a boost controller, install it according to the manufacturer’s instructions. This may involve connecting it to the vacuum lines and the wastegate.

Step 7: Final Checks

Before starting the engine, double-check all connections and ensure there are no loose components. Verify that the oil and coolant lines are secure and that there are no leaks.

Step 8: Start the Engine

Reconnect the battery and start the engine. Allow it to idle for a few minutes while monitoring for any leaks or unusual noises. Check the oil pressure to ensure the turbo is receiving adequate lubrication.

Step 9: Test Drive

Once the engine has warmed up, take the vehicle for a test drive. Gradually increase the throttle to ensure the turbo is functioning properly and that the vehicle is running smoothly.

Troubleshooting Tips

  • If you experience low oil pressure, check the oil feed line for clogs.
  • Listen for any unusual sounds that may indicate a problem with the turbo.
  • Monitor boost levels and ensure they are within the expected range.
